  1. Look for something small: Consider your family size, your lifestyle, visitors, storage and your pets; accordingly decide the number of rooms you require. Keep in mind living in downtown Pune or the hub of the city, can prove to be costly. Hence, if not required, opt for a relatively smaller size house.
  1. Share the apartment: Sharing the apartment can take away a significant amount of pressure from your finances. However, make sure you obtain the landlord’s permission first, and then draw up a written agreement with your flatmate stating he is obligated to pay his share of the rent.
  1. Consider transportation costs: The cost of living in Pune city can be expensive if you have to travel far to get to your destination, like school, college or work. Make sure the place you pick is either close to your job or education institution or the transportation from your new home to other destinations is good and cheap.
  1. Pick a place outside: Usually rents are much more affordable on the outskirts of any city. Not only you can save money on your rent, but you will also be able to afford a bigger place, if required. However, there can be a flip side to this. Schools, colleges, business hubs, shopping malls and other vital components that make the city thrive are generally located at its heart. So, check out apartments in the suburbs, which are conveniently located near your work or children’s school.
  1. Look for a student concession: Many landlords offer a concession to students. Ask your landlord before you settle on a flat. Student concessions can be a major game changer for you as they can help you save a lot of money on rent.
  1. Negotiate: The prices specified are not necessarily fixed; there is always a scope for negotiation. So try negotiating with the landlord to see if he budges in terms of the rent amount. However, you can do it only if you have done proper research on the rents of the places in the vicinity.
  1. Let go of amenities: A few old buildings, if usually three or four storied, do not have elevators and/or do not employ security guards; hence their rents are also low. If you do not mind climbing up and down the stairs and do not keep any valuables at home, you can get the place for a song. However, check out the structural strength of the building.
